Are you a compassionate and driven Registered Nurse looking to make a positive impact in the lives of others? Aetna is seeking a Case Manager RN in San Antonio, TX to join our team and help coordinate care for our members. In this role, you will use your clinical expertise to assess, plan, implement, and coordinate healthcare services for our members, ensuring they receive the best possible care. If you are passionate about improving healthcare outcomes and have a strong background in nursing, we want you to be a part of our team.
- Provide high-quality and compassionate care to Aetna members in the San Antonio, TX area.
- Use clinical expertise to assess, plan, implement, and coordinate healthcare services for members.
- Work collaboratively with other healthcare professionals to ensure the best possible outcomes for members.
- Conduct thorough assessments of members' medical needs and develop personalized care plans.
- Monitor and evaluate members' progress and adjust care plans as needed.
- Advocate for members' needs and ensure they receive appropriate and timely healthcare services.
- Maintain accurate and up-to-date documentation of members' care plans and progress.
- Communicate effectively with members, families, and healthcare providers to promote understanding and coordination of care.
- Stay current on industry trends and evidence-based practices to continuously improve care coordination.
- Adhere to all regulatory and compliance guidelines to ensure the highest quality of care for members.
- Participate in interdisciplinary team meetings to discuss and coordinate care for members.
- Collaborate with community resources to help meet members' social, emotional, and physical needs.
- Continuously strive to improve healthcare outcomes for members and identify opportunities for process improvement.
- Serve as a role model and mentor for other healthcare professionals.
- Embody Aetna's values and mission in all aspects of the job.
Bachelor's Degree In Nursing (Bsn) From An Accredited University
Current And Unrestricted Registered Nurse (Rn) License In The State Of Texas
Minimum Of 3 Years Of Clinical Experience As An Rn, Preferably In Case Management Or Care Coordination
Strong Knowledge Of Healthcare Systems, Insurance, And Utilization Management Processes
Excellent Communication, Organizational, And Critical Thinking Skills To Effectively Manage A Caseload And Collaborate With Interdisciplinary Teams.

According to JobzMall, the average salary range for a Case Manager RN-San Antonio, TX in Texas, USA is $59,000 to $83,000 per year. This can vary depending on factors such as experience, education, and specific job responsibilities. Some case manager RNs may also receive additional benefits such as health insurance, retirement plans, and paid time off.

Aetna Inc. is an American managed health care company that sells traditional and consumer directed health care insurance and related services, such as medical, pharmaceutical, dental, behavioral health, long-term care, and disability plans, primarily through employer-paid (fully or partly) insurance and benefit programs, and through Medicare. Since November 28, 2018, the company has been a subsidiary of CVS Health.
